Недоспектрум NEDOCON-48K и далее NEDOCON-56K

Старый спектрумистский форум

Moderator: Shaos

Взять да и построить?

Да, поможем
5
36%
Да, строй сам
4
29%
Не, не надо
1
7%
Глупость какая
1
7%
А мне пофиг
3
21%
 
Total votes: 14
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Недоспектрум NEDOCON-48K и далее NEDOCON-56K

Post by Shaos »

А что если взять да и построить на рассыпухе наикошерный спектрум, который 100% повторяет ВСЁ, включая чтение четвёрками? ;)

Про картриджи NEDOCARD отрезано в другой топик: viewtopic.php?f=35&t=11609

Про ShaosBox отрезано в другой топик: viewtopic.php?f=35&t=11610

P.S. Решил прожэкт недоспектрума назвать NEDOCON-48K - как бы созвучно пентагон/скорпион :roll:

P.P.S. UPDATE 2019: Концепция изменилась т.к. для "повторяет всё" есть Харлекин :no:
Мне было бы более интересно шагнуть в сторону, раздвинув рамки спектрумовости так сказать :)
А именно уйти в VGA (без скандаблеров) и на большие скорости (вплоть до 25.175 МГц) :roll:


P.P.P.S. UPDATE 2021: Так как домен nedocon.com я отпустил много-много лет назад, то я решил переименовать проект в NEDOGON :rotate:

P.P.P.P.S. UPDATE 2023: Так как домен nedocon.com ко мне вернулся (с небольшой переплатой), то я решил переименовать проект обратно в NEDOCON :rotate:
Last edited by Shaos on 15 Jun 2013 23:29, edited 3 times in total.
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
Lavr
Supreme God
Posts: 16680
Joined: 21 Oct 2009 08:08
Location: Россия

Post by Lavr »

А если просто "РКа-ку" доделать? Да и "Спецтрум" у тебя есть недопаянный... :wink:
Last edited by Lavr on 12 Jun 2013 15:33, edited 2 times in total.
iLavr
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Post by Shaos »

Ага есть - недопаянный :oops:

Но я человек настроения: есть настроение - делаю, нет настроения - переключаюсь на что-то другое...
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
Lavr
Supreme God
Posts: 16680
Joined: 21 Oct 2009 08:08
Location: Россия

Post by Lavr »

Из всех "кошерных и некошерных" "Спецтрумов" лично мне нравится "Красногорск" за
идею формирования всей фигни в ПЗУ и "ZX-NEXT" за оригинальность идеи.
Я бы поддержал идею максимально компактного схемотехнически "Спецтрума"с возможно
оригинальной схемотехникой, пусть даже не совсем "кошерного".
iLavr
User avatar
Lavr
Supreme God
Posts: 16680
Joined: 21 Oct 2009 08:08
Location: Россия

Post by Lavr »

Lavr wrote:Я бы поддержал идею максимально компактного схемотехнически "Спецтрума"с возможно
оригинальной схемотехникой, пусть даже не совсем "кошерного".
Ну, к примеру - процессор + память, а вся "обвязка" выполнена на PIC-ах, а?
И чтоб экран можно было переключать из убогого 256х192 в нормальный - 384х256.
Предусмотреть вывод отдельно на LCD без монитора - вот эта идея тоже красивая.
iLavr
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Post by Shaos »

О - я тоже всю экранную фингю в ПЗУ хочу засунуть - тогда теоретически можно простой перепрошивкой делать из спектрума пентагон или 60-герцовый таймекс...

Пик боюсь не справится, а вот SX - может

Но это потом - для начала хотелось бы на рассыпухе чтобы из вумных камней был только старичок Z80A
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
Lavr
Supreme God
Posts: 16680
Joined: 21 Oct 2009 08:08
Location: Россия

Post by Lavr »

Shaos wrote:Пик боюсь не справится, а вот SX
Ну Пики - тоже не сидят на ..оппе - 628-й очень даже шустр! :o
Shaos wrote:для начала хотелось бы на рассыпухе чтобы из вумных камней был только старичок Z80A
А это - можешь плату свою допаять... так там всё и будет.... :wink:
iLavr
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Post by Shaos »

Например счётчик на четырёх 74LS163 плюс 74LS74 - два раза по девять (H0...H8, V0...V8) из которых на 8-килобайтную ПЗУ идут H3, H4, H5, H6, H7, H8, V2, V3, V4, V5, V6, V7, V8, а на выходе получаем 8 сигналов, защёлкивающихся в регистре:

D0: /VIDEO - видео разрешено;
D1: /BORDER - бордер разрешён;
D2: /HSYNC - горизонтальная синхра;
D3: /VSYNC - вертикальная синхра;
D4: /HCLR - сброс горизонтального счётчика;
D5: /VCLR - сброс вертикального счётчика;
D6: /LOAD - сигнал начала предзагрузки данных в строке;
D7: /INT - сигнал кадрового прерывания.

Выходные сигналы получаются по длине кратны знакоместу (т.к. H0,H1,H2 на адрес ПЗУ не идут) - вроде по цифрам всё получается...
Last edited by Shaos on 12 Jun 2013 18:27, edited 1 time in total.
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
MC68k
Retired
Posts: 1328
Joined: 25 Jul 2011 00:14
Location: WWW

Re: недоспектрум

Post by MC68k »

Shaos wrote:А что если взять да и построить на рассыпухе наикошерный спектрум, который 100% повторяет ВСЁ, включая чтение четвёрками? ;)
а построй, только на динамике, чтобы все как положено - 16к медленные и 32к быстрые
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Re: недоспектрум

Post by Shaos »

MC68k wrote:
Shaos wrote:А что если взять да и построить на рассыпухе наикошерный спектрум, который 100% повторяет ВСЁ, включая чтение четвёрками? ;)
а построй, только на динамике, чтобы все как положено - 16к медленные и 32к быстрые
Угу - как положено, 16К медленные, 32К быстрые, НО на статике :)

В наше время сигналы RAS/CAS это отстой ;)

Да и схема без них сильно проще будет...
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
MC68k
Retired
Posts: 1328
Joined: 25 Jul 2011 00:14
Location: WWW

Post by MC68k »

НИЗАЧОТ! давай уж с RASами и с CASами, а то ведь пентагон получится. и схема будет ненамного проще, если на статике - всего на один буфер меньше. я сам склоняюсь к статике ибо у меня 157 мультиплексоров много, могу даже выбирать производителя и страну изготовления, а вот со 153 напряженка.
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Post by Shaos »

MC68k wrote:НИЗАЧОТ! давай уж с RASами и с CASами, а то ведь пентагон получится. и схема будет ненамного проще, если на статике - всего на один буфер меньше. я сам склоняюсь к статике ибо у меня 157 мультиплексоров много, могу даже выбирать производителя и страну изготовления, а вот со 153 напряженка.
Для любителей RAS/CAS-ов есть Harlequin с динамической памятью :)

Про картриджи NEDOCARD отрезано в другой топик: viewtopic.php?f=35&t=11609

Самое интересное, что в картридж можно затолкать больше 32К

P.S. В будущем можно и всякие экзотические видеорежимы прикрутить, причём безвейтовые ;)
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
Lavr
Supreme God
Posts: 16680
Joined: 21 Oct 2009 08:08
Location: Россия

Post by Lavr »

Shaos wrote:Самое интересное, что в картридж можно затолкать больше 32К
Не удивил - поскольку я копался с Дендиками - там в картридж и запихивают дофига больше.
А поскольку на разъём там выведено минимум нужных контактов, то и схемотических трюков -
пруд пруди!

Вот если бы cделать так - нижняя половина - минимальный компик с ЖК индикатором,
ну хотя бы вот так или вот так.

А с верхним картриджем - полноценный комп получается той или иной конфигурации.
iLavr
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Post by Shaos »

Lavr wrote:
Shaos wrote:Самое интересное, что в картридж можно затолкать больше 32К
Не удивил - поскольку я копался с Дендиками - там в картридж и запихивают дофига больше.
А поскольку на разъём там выведено минимум нужных контактов, то и схемотических трюков -
пруд пруди!

Вот если бы cделать так - нижняя половина - минимальный компик с ЖК индикатором,
ну хотя бы вот так или вот так.

А с верхним картриджем - полноценный комп получается той или иной конфигурации.
Да - я клаву именно на той же плате и предполагал :)

Первая мысль у меня была вообще слелать спектрум-16К, а 48К получать путём втыкания картриджа с 32К ОЗУ, но потом понял, что это неудобно для маленьких игр - скажем игра только 8К и чтобы ей заюзать всю возможную память, на картридж придется ставить ещё 24К ОЗУ - поэтому и остановился на варианте, когда мать имеет всё ОЗУ, а картридж может включать свои части в общую память компьютера окнами по 8К.

Про ShaosBox отрезано в другой топик: viewtopic.php?f=35&t=11610
Я тут за главного - если что шлите мыло на me собака shaos точка net
User avatar
Shaos
Admin
Posts: 24011
Joined: 08 Jan 2003 23:22
Location: Silicon Valley

Post by Shaos »

Shaos wrote:Например счётчик на четырёх 74LS163 плюс 74LS74 - два раза по девять (H0...H8, V0...V8) из которых на 8-килобайтную ПЗУ идут H3, H4, H5, H6, H7, H8, V2, V3, V4, V5, V6, V7, V8...
Вобщем как-то так:

Image

Счётчик точек с синхронным сбросом (74LS163), а счётчик строк - с асинхронным (74LS161) - это чтобы можно было без младших 2 бит сбросить в ноль...

P.S. Выяснилась неприятная деталь - осцилляторов на 14 МГц нигде нет, да и кристаллы тоже фиг найдёшь - купил непойми чего на ебее - поглядим...
Last edited by Shaos on 15 Jun 2013 23:26, edited 4 times in total.
Я тут за главного - если что шлите мыло на me собака shaos точка net